Ridiculously easy, bold and flavorful crockpot buffalo shredded chicken. All the chicken wing flavor you love in an easy, healthy dish you can have waiting for you when you get home!
Place chicken in the bottom of your slow cooker. Cover with buffalo sauce. Cook on low for 5 hours.
Stir Greek yogurt and cornstarch together in a small bowl. Set aside for a few minutes while you shred the chicken. You can either gently pull the chicken apart with two forks in the slow cooker, or remove the chicken, shred and replace back in the slow cooker.
Add a tablespoon of sauce into the Greek yogurt and stir to temper. Repeat 1-2 times, then transfer Greek yogurt to your slow cooker and stir all ingredients to combine.
Serve topped with bleu cheese and celery, or use to make sandwiches, salads, etc. Leftovers may be stored in the refrigerator for 5-7 days.
